legongju.com
我们一直在努力
2024-12-23 18:09 | 星期一

SQL Server数据备份策略如何选择

选择合适的SQL Server数据备份策略是确保数据安全性和业务连续性的关键。以下是一些关于SQL Server数据备份策略选择的建议:

备份类型选择

  • 完整备份:备份数据库中的所有数据和日志文件,恢复时只需最近的一次完整备份和一个事务日志备份。
  • 差异备份:备份自上次完整备份以来发生变化的数据,恢复时需要最近的一次完整备份和最新的差异备份。
  • 事务日志备份:备份自上次备份以来的事务日志,对于保持点之后的事务非常关键,可以实现到特定时间点的恢复。

备份策略实施建议

  • 定期执行:根据数据量和业务需求,定期执行完整备份、差异备份和事务日志备份。
  • 自动化备份任务:使用SQL Server Agent创建作业来自动执行备份。
  • 监控和测试:定期检查备份文件的完整性,并执行恢复测试以确保备份有效。

备份策略优缺点

  • 完整备份:优点是恢复简单,缺点是备份时间长,占用存储空间大。
  • 差异备份:优点是备份速度快,占用存储空间少,缺点是恢复过程相对复杂。
  • 事务日志备份:优点是可以实现最小化数据丢失和快速恢复到特定时间点,缺点是恢复时间可能较长。

备份策略最佳实践

  • 定期备份:确保对数据库进行定期备份,以防止数据丢失。
  • 多种备份方式:使用不同的备份方式,如完整备份、增量备份和差异备份,以确保数据安全性和备份效率。
  • 存储位置:将备份文件存储在安全的地方,可以选择本地存储、云存储或远程服务器等方式进行备份文件存储。

通过综合考虑备份类型、实施建议、优缺点以及最佳实践,可以制定出适合自己业务需求的SQL Server数据备份策略。

未经允许不得转载 » 本文链接:https://www.legongju.com/article/12923.html

相关推荐

  • sql server定时任务怎么写

    sql server定时任务怎么写

    在 SQL Server 中,你可以使用 SQL Server Agent 来创建定时任务。以下是创建一个简单定时任务的步骤: 打开 SQL Server Management Studio (SSMS),连接到你的 ...

  • sql server定时任务是什么

    sql server定时任务是什么

    SQL Server定时任务主要指的是SQL Server Agent,这是SQL Server中的一个重要组件。SQL Server Agent是一个作业调度器,用于在SQL Server中自动执行计划任务,可...

  • sql server定时任务注意事项

    sql server定时任务注意事项

    在使用SQL Server定时任务时,有几个关键的注意事项需要考虑: 确保SQL Server Agent服务正在运行:SQL Server Agent是执行定时任务的关键组件。如果该服务未启动...

  • sql server定时任务能做什么

    sql server定时任务能做什么

    SQL Server定时任务(SQL Server Agent)是一个在SQL Server中用于执行预定操作的任务调度器。通过使用SQL Server Agent,您可以创建、管理和自动执行计划任务,...

  • redis数据库管理工具有哪些

    redis数据库管理工具有哪些

    Redis数据库管理工具有很多,以下是一些常见且受欢迎的工具: RedisDesktopManager (RDM):这是一款流行的开源Redis图形化管理工具,支持跨平台使用,如Windows、...

  • redis怎么查看当前是哪个数据库

    redis怎么查看当前是哪个数据库

    要查看Redis当前使用的数据库,您可以执行以下命令:
    SELECT 其中是您希望查看的数据库索引。Redis默认提供了16个数据库(编号为0到15),您可以通过这个命...

  • redis的set数据结构是什么

    redis的set数据结构是什么

    Redis的Set数据结构是一种无序且不重复的数据集合。它支持添加、删除、查找和判断元素是否存在等操作。Set中的每个元素都是唯一的,即使两个元素具有相同的值,它...

  • linux如何查看redis数据

    linux如何查看redis数据

    在Linux系统中,你可以使用redis-cli命令行工具来查看Redis数据库中的数据。以下是一些常用的redis-cli命令: 查看所有键: redis-cli keys * 查看指定键的值: ...